Sakhi One-Stop Centre in Dhubri, Assam

Integrated medical, police, legal, and counselling support, plus shelter for up to five days, for women facing violence.

Dhubri, Assam · Pillar: Agency & Engagement

Women's mobility composite score in Dhubri is 31.8%, behind the typical district. 84% of women take part in all three major household decisions, better than the typical district. The Sakhi One-Stop Centre supports women whose safety and agency fall short of this.

Youth opportunity in Dhubri

68% of registered enterprises are in services while 32% are in manufacturing. Only 2% of employment is in small and medium enterprises. 71% of school-age children are enrolled in higher secondary school (classes 9–12).

In Dhubri, which ranks 31 of 35 in Assam for youth opportunity, the overall opportunity score is 41.5 out of 100. On women who own a house at 45.4%, it sits close to the national mark.
